    English Idiom: Get to the bottom of (something) Business today is all about big data. Yes, that’s right, if you want to get to the bottom of something, big data has the answers you desire. To get to the bottom of something means to discover the hidden explanations for why something happens or doesn’t happen.…

    English Idiom: Straight from the horse’s mouth If you want or need the whole truth about something, it is better to get it straight from the horse’s mouth. You need to get the information from someone who has direct, personal knowledge of the subject. Everybody loves a rumour. Gossip flows through the grapevine at the…
